Transaction 61a5e25b0b204138785e6637da99016decf2dfadf620adea6f9bee8b51c1b8ca

2 Input
2 Outputs
  • 61a5e25b0b204138785e6637da99016decf2dfadf620adea6f9bee8b51c1b8ca:0
  • value  386000000
    address  3QFtYbR22en2AizTb7JVFA9bL2rf1fbNJr
  • 61a5e25b0b204138785e6637da99016decf2dfadf620adea6f9bee8b51c1b8ca:1
  • value  553301282088
    address  1KNm4K8GUK8sMoxc2Z3zU8Uv5FDVjrA72p